Reality TV star and comedian Deeone has expressed his disappointment with his experience at Hilda Baci’s Guinness World Record attempt to cook the largest pot of jollof rice at Eko Hotel.
Deeone paid ₦4,000 for parking but was shoved in the crowd and couldn’t taste the jollof rice. He jokingly asked Hilda Baci how long it would take her to cook beans, adding that if he doesn’t eat on time, it gives him a headache.
Deeone described the attendees at the event as “Ratels,” implying they were desperate for food. He questioned the value of his experience, comparing it to buying a plate of rice at a restaurant. While applying lip gloss, Deeone humorously noted that the shine on his lips came from the product, not Hilda’s jollof rice.
Fans reacted to Deeone’s video with mixed opinions, some sympathizing with his experience and others finding his comments hilarious. Some fans commended Hilda Baci for her effort and wished her continued success, while others joked about the situation.
